About Rivet Nuts
Rivet Nuts, also known as anchor rivets, rivet anchors, rivnuts, and threaded pop rivets, are fasteners that are used to provide a secure connection between two pieces of material. They are designed to be inserted into one side of the material and then pulled through with a tool that tightens the nut onto the other side.
Types of Rivet Nuts
There are several types of Rivet Nuts available depending on the application. Steel knurled flanged rivet nuts are commonly used for heavier materials while stainless steel rivnuts can be used for lighter materials. Some applications may require different sizes or shapes of Rivet Nuts in order to achieve a desired result.
How Rivet Nuts Are Made
Rivet Nuts are typically made from metal alloys such as aluminum or steel. The manufacturing process involves using a tool to press the metal alloy into shape and then threading it so that it can be securely attached to another piece of material. This process is often done in high-volume production environments.
Industries That Use Rivet Nuts
Rivet Nuts have many applications across various industries including automotive, aerospace, marine, construction and manufacturing. Professionals in these fields use them to quickly and securely join two pieces of material together without having to use traditional bolts or screws.
